Best Zones & Areas to Explore in Municipio Palavecino, Venezuela
Cabudare is the main town and a great base for exploring the municipality. From here, you can easily access the national park and other attractions. The surrounding countryside offers stunning views and opportunities for hiking and exploring. Each area has its own unique charm, from the bustling city centre to the peaceful rural landscapes.

When’s the Best Time to Go?
Venezuela enjoys a tropical climate. The best time to visit is during the dry season (typically December to April), when the weather is warm and sunny. However, the shoulder seasons (May-June and September-November) offer a good balance of pleasant weather and fewer crowds.
Transportation Options in Municipio Palavecino, Venezuela
Getting around Municipio Palavecino is relatively straightforward. Public transport is available, although it might not be as frequent or reliable as in larger cities. Taxis are also readily available. For exploring Parque Nacional Yacambú, you might need to hire a car or join an organised tour.
